Network Security Automation Engineer

We are seeking a Network Security Automation Engineer to join our team in Porto (hybrid model).

Here you’ll contact with the European stock market area and will be able to work in a project for a leading global trading platform that knows the importance of surveillance issues and provides technology and managed services to third parties. You’ll also be able to experience a multicultural environment with a strong people culture, being on a team that is spread across several European countries, such as Denmark, Italy, Norway and Portugal.

Requirements:

  • Strong hands-on experience in network automation, with advanced knowledge of Python, including networking libraries such as Netmiko, NAPALM, PyEZ, or Nornir, as well as Bash/Shell, YAML/JSON, Jinja2, and Ansible.
  • Solid experience with Ansible, Git, and CI/CD tools such as Jenkins, GitLab CI, or GitHub Actions, including Infrastructure as Code and automated testing/deployment workflows.
  • Strong knowledge of network management and automation protocols, including NETCONF, RESTCONF, gNMI, gNOI, and vendor-specific REST APIs, combined with a good understanding of Layer 2/3 networking protocols.
  • Experience with network monitoring and observability, including SNMP, NetFlow/sFlow, streaming telemetry, log analysis and correlation. Knowledge of tools such as Grafana, Kibana, Coralogix, Prometheus, or Power BI is an advantage.
  • Solid experience with Linux system administration, preferably Red Hat Linux, including shell scripting, system configuration, performance tuning, and integration with network automation tools.

Responsibilities:

  • Design and implement automation frameworks and reusable solutions for multi-vendor network and security environments, including Cisco, Juniper, Arista, and Fortinet.
  • Develop and maintain Ansible playbooks, roles, collections, custom plugins, dynamic inventories, and Jinja2 templates to automate device provisioning, configuration management, and network changes.
  • Implement automated CI/CD workflows for network infrastructure, including pre-change validation, automated testing, rollback mechanisms, post-change verification, and Git-based Infrastructure as Code practices.
  • Develop network monitoring and validation solutions, including automated health checks, performance monitoring, alerting, state validation, and automated remediation of common network issues.
  • Contribute to the automation of data center, disaster recovery, and high-availability environments, including VXLAN-EVPN provisioning, traffic engineering, configuration backup and restoration, failover validation, documentation, and operational reporting.
